UNIDENTIFIED INUIT ARTIST, PANNIQTUUQ (PANGNIRTUNG)
Qamutiik (Komatik) Ring, c. 1980sivory, size 6 3/4, interior width: 11/16 in (1.8 cm)
unsigned;
with affixed jewellery tag, from La Guilde (The Canadian Handicrafts Guild), in black ink, "50.00”;
accompanied by a note from C.J.G. Molson, "Dec 1984 / Eskimo, Bought at / (C.H.G. "Canadian Guild of Crafts) / Dog sled ivory ring / 8 cross pieces [stuck] bars / Believed to be from / Pangnirtung, Walrus ivory / C.J.G.M".LOT 59
ESTIMATE: $60 — $90Further images

This ring transforms a qamutiik (komatik) into adornment, the creamy surface of the ivory polished smooth to the touch, ridges catching light like snow-packed runners gliding across ice.
Provenance
Ex. Coll. Colin John Grasset Molson (C.J.G ), Montreal.
